What Actually Happens When an SSL Certificate Expires

The sequence is fast and unforgiving.

The moment a certificate expires, every major browser displays a full-screen security warning to any visitor who attempts to load the page. The warning language is alarming by design — “Your connection is not private,” “Attackers might be trying to steal your information.” The page content is hidden behind the warning. Visitors must actively click through a secondary screen to proceed.

Most don’t. Studies consistently show that browser security warnings stop the vast majority of visitors — estimates range from 70% to 90% abandonment at the warning screen. For a client site with steady traffic, an expired certificate effectively takes the site offline from a conversion perspective even if the server is running normally.

The SEO Consequence

Search engines treat SSL as a ranking signal. Google confirmed HTTPS as a ranking factor in 2014, and the weight of that signal has grown since. A site that has been running on HTTPS and suddenly loses its certificate doesn’t just show a browser warning — it sends a negative signal to search crawlers.

Google Search Console flags SSL errors. Crawl coverage can decrease. In competitive search environments, the ranking drop from a certificate lapse can take weeks or months to fully recover after the certificate is renewed — because ranking changes don’t reverse instantly, and because crawl cycles don’t happen on demand.

For a client site that relies on organic search traffic for leads or revenue, this is a compounding problem. The certificate lapses. Traffic drops. Rankings slip. The certificate gets renewed. Rankings recover — slowly, over weeks, as Google recrawls and reindexes. The client notices the traffic gap long before it fully closes.

The Conversion and Revenue Consequence

Beyond the SEO impact, the direct conversion effect of an expired certificate is immediate and severe.

E-commerce sites become non-functional in any practical sense — no visitor will enter payment details on a page displaying a security warning, regardless of how legitimate the business is. Lead generation forms see abandonment rates that approach 100%. Even purely informational sites lose credibility: a business whose website shows a security warning appears, to the visitor, like a business that doesn’t maintain its own infrastructure.

For clients who run paid advertising, there’s an additional layer: Google Ads and Meta Ads both flag destination URLs that return SSL errors, leading to ad disapprovals and campaign suspension. The marketing budget keeps getting charged for impressions or clicks directed at a disapproved destination, or the ads stop running entirely while the certificate issue is resolved.

Why Manual Checking Isn’t Enough

SSL certificates have fixed expiry dates. There is no ambiguity, no unexpected failure — the date is set when the certificate is issued, visible to anyone who checks it, and the expiry is entirely predictable.

The reason certificates still lapse is that checking is manual and remembering is unreliable.

A developer who set up an SSL certificate eighteen months ago for a client’s site has moved on to other projects. The hosting provider sends a renewal reminder email that lands in a cluttered inbox. The client’s IT contact who usually handles renewals is on holiday. Auto-renewal is configured but the payment method on file has expired.

None of these scenarios are unusual. All of them result in the same outcome: a certificate expires, a site goes down in a way that looks like catastrophic failure to any visitor, and someone spends an afternoon explaining what happened and why it shouldn’t happen again.
